Love, love, love this projector! It fits in the palm of your hand, portable with a battery that lasts over 2 hours. We connect it to a Samsung Galaxy S8 phone or our Chromebook using a (not included) HDMI/usb-c cable and connect the phone to a Bluetooth speaker for great sound! (You can instructions in YouTube) We project it to a wall for a decent 80" plus picture. Yes, it needs to be dark, and no, it's not a crystal clear display - it's under $100 after all so don't expect that. A perfect beginner's or starter projector that will make you feel just like being at the drive-in!

great little projector for the money. It's tiny, lightweight, and has a tripod mount on the bottom, which was all i was looking for for a specific use case. It's also surprisingly powerful and can project a 6' wide image from about 10' away in a dark room (useless with any other lights on). It also has an internal battery, which I didn't expect, and can run for a while without power plugged in (haven't tested how long).
